在产品开发的过程中,调试是一个至关重要的环节。它不仅关系到产品的质量,还直接影响到用户体验和公司声誉。那么,如何确保产品交付调试的每个环节都能顺利运行呢?下面,我们就来揭秘产品交付调试背后的秘密。
调试前的准备工作
1. 明确调试目标
在开始调试之前,首先要明确调试的目标。这包括了解产品功能、性能要求,以及可能存在的问题。明确目标有助于提高调试效率,避免盲目寻找问题。
2. 准备调试工具
调试过程中需要使用各种工具,如调试器、日志分析工具、性能分析工具等。在调试前,确保所有工具都已准备就绪,并熟悉其使用方法。
3. 建立测试环境
为了模拟真实环境,需要搭建一个与生产环境相似的测试环境。这包括硬件、软件、网络等方面的配置。
调试过程中的关键环节
1. 问题定位
在调试过程中,首先要快速定位问题。以下是一些常见的问题定位方法:
- 日志分析:通过分析日志,找出异常信息,缩小问题范围。
- 代码审查:检查代码是否存在逻辑错误或潜在风险。
- 性能分析:使用性能分析工具,找出性能瓶颈。
2. 问题修复
在定位问题后,需要针对性地进行修复。以下是一些常见的修复方法:
- 代码修改:修复代码中的错误或潜在风险。
- 参数调整:调整系统参数,优化性能。
- 配置优化:优化系统配置,提高稳定性。
3. 测试验证
在修复问题后,需要进行测试验证,确保问题已得到解决。以下是一些常见的测试方法:
- 单元测试:测试单个模块的功能是否正常。
- 集成测试:测试模块之间的交互是否正常。
- 性能测试:测试系统的性能是否满足要求。
调试后的总结与优化
1. 总结经验
在调试过程中,总结经验教训,为今后的工作提供参考。
2. 优化流程
根据调试过程中的发现,优化调试流程,提高调试效率。
3. 持续改进
不断学习新技术、新方法,提高自己的调试能力。
总结
产品交付调试是一个复杂的过程,需要我们掌握各种技巧和方法。通过以上揭秘,相信大家对产品交付调试有了更深入的了解。在今后的工作中,不断积累经验,提高自己的调试能力,为打造高质量产品贡献力量。
